Hilary Duff is "really grateful" for her husband Matthew Koma. The 'Younger' star has heaped praise on her spouse, as she says he has been helping around the house whilst the family self-isolates amid the coronavirus pandemic, and has even come up with a "routine" that means Hilary can "sleep in" in the mornings.
Speaking about her beau, Hilary - who has Luca, eight, with Mike Comrie, and Banks, 21 months, with Matthew - said: "We are doing great, and he's the best.
He is so sweet. So, he has his own studio and he goes to work Monday through Friday. He's been really busy right now, obviously, because he can do everything alone. "But I'm home all day.
